exportdefault{init:function(){console.log("初始化百度地图脚本...");constAK="AK密钥";constapiVersion ="3.0";consttimestamp =newDate().getTime();constBMap_URL ="http://api.map.baidu.com/getscript?v="+ apiVersion +"&ak="+AK+"&services=&t="+ timestamp;returnnewPromise((resolve, reje...
方式一:添加地图容器直接在JS代码中使用百度地图API:步骤如下 百度地图2d vue-baidu-map,1.1在需要的地方 ,例如在在public/index.html中引入百度地图的JS API库:1 1.2在Vue组件的模板中添加地图容器 :1.3然后在Vue组件的mounted生命周期钩子中初始化百度地图: new BMapGL.Map(this.$refs...
document.write(''); })(); 从返回内容中看出,立即执行函数中再次插入了另外一个<scirpt>标签,经检查发现这个<scirpt>实际并没有插入成功。 既然如此,那就直接把脚本放到我们上面的代码中去加载,结果就真的成功了。 修改优化后的代码如下: export default { init: function (){ console.log("初始化百度地图...
exportdefault{init:function(){//console.log("初始化百度地图脚本...");constAK="AK**";constBMap_URL="https://api.map.baidu.com/api?v=2.0&ak="+AK+"&s=1&callback=onBMapCallback";returnnewPromise((resolve,reject)=>{// 如果已加载直接返回if(typeofBMap!=="undefined"){resolve(BMap);re...
然后考虑使用异步加载的方式,结合参考网上方案,单独创建baidu-map.js脚本: export default { init: function (){ const AK = "AK密钥"; const apiVersion = "3.0"; const timestamp = new Date().getTime(); const BMap_URL = "http://api.map.baidu.com/api?v="+ apiVersion +"&ak="+ AK +"...
然后考虑使用异步加载的方式,结合参考网上方案,单独创建baidu-map.js脚本: export default { init: function (){ const AK = "AK密钥"; const apiVersion = "3.0"; const timestamp = new Date().getTime(); const BMap_URL = "http://api.map.baidu.com/api?v="+ apiVersion +"&...
然后考虑使用异步加载的方式,结合参考网上方案,单独创建baidu-map.js脚本: export default { init: function (){ const AK = "AK密钥"; const apiVersion = "3.0"; const timestamp = new Date().getTime(); const BMap_URL = "http://api.map.baidu.com/api?v="+ apiVersion +"&...
既然如此,那就直接把脚本放到我们上面的代码中去加载,结果就真的成功了。 修改优化后的代码如下: exportdefault{init:function(){console.log("初始化百度地图脚本...");constAK="AK密钥";constapiVersion ="3.0";consttimestamp =newDate().getTime();constBMap_URL ="http://api.map.baidu.com/getscript...
然后考虑使用异步加载的方式,结合参考网上方案,单独创建baidu-map.js脚本: export default { init: function (){ const AK = "AK密钥"; const apiVersion = "3.0"; const timestamp = new Date().getTime(); const BMap_URL = "http://api.map.baidu.com/api?v="+ apiVersion +"&ak="+ AK +"...